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Garlic Butter Baked Chicken Thighs
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Begin by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C) and make sure to center the oven rack for even cooking. This temperature is perfect for creating that ideal crispy skin while keeping the chicken moist and juicy. Take a moment to gather your ingredients and have everything within reach for a smooth cooking experience.
Step 2: Prepare the Chicken
Pat the chicken thighs dry with paper towels, which is essential for achieving that golden, crispy skin. Season generously on both sides with salt and black pepper, ensuring each thigh is evenly coated. The seasoning will not only enhance the flavor but will also help create a beautiful crust as the chicken bakes.
Step 3: Sear the Chicken
In a 10-inch cast iron skillet, heat a couple of tablespoons of olive oil over medium heat. Once the oil shimmers, carefully place the seasoned chicken thighs skin-side down into the skillet. Sear for about 5–7 minutes until the skin is golden brown and crisp. This initial step adds depth to the flavor, making your Garlic Butter Baked Chicken Thighs even more irresistible.
Step 4: Flip the Thighs and Add Flavor
Gently flip the seared chicken thighs using tongs, and if there’s excessive fat in the skillet, carefully discard some of it. Reduce the heat to low, then add in the unsalted butter and crushed garlic cloves. As the butter melts, it will infuse the chicken with mouthwatering flavor that complements the garlicky aroma filling your kitchen.
Step 5: Stir and Transfer to Oven
Once the butter has completely melted, give the garlic a quick stir, cooking for about 30 seconds until fragrant. This creates a luscious garlic butter sauce that will enhance the dish. Now, transfer the skillet directly into the preheated oven, allowing the chicken to bake evenly and soak up all the combined flavors.
Step 6: Bake Until Perfectly Cooked
Bake the chicken thighs for approximately 30 minutes, or until the internal temperature reaches 165°F (75°C). You’ll know they’re ready when the skin is crispy and the juices run clear. This step allows the thighs to cook through, ensuring tender, moist meat while still retaining that inviting golden color.
Step 7: Finish with Garlic Butter Sauce
Once out of the oven, carefully spoon the melted garlic butter from the skillet over the chicken thighs. This final touch adds an extra burst of flavor. Sprinkle fresh parsley on top for a vibrant pop of color and to brighten up the dish.
Step 8: Let It Rest
Before serving, allow the Garlic Butter Baked Chicken Thighs to rest for 5 minutes. This step lets the juices redistribute throughout the meat, ensuring that every bite is as juicy as possible. It’s the perfect moment to admire your beautifully cooked chicken!

How to Store and Freeze Garlic Butter Baked Chicken Thighs
Room Temperature: Do not leave cooked chicken at room temperature for more than 2 hours to maintain food safety.
Fridge: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days, ensuring the chicken stays moist and flavorful.
Freezer: For longer storage, freeze the chicken in a freezer-safe container for up to 3 months. Thaw in the refrigerator before reheating.
Reheating: To reheat, place chicken thighs in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for 15–20 minutes, drizzling with a bit of fresh garlic butter to keep them juicy.

Make Ahead Options
Garlic Butter Baked Chicken Thighs are a fantastic recipe for meal prep! You can season the chicken thighs with salt and pepper and keep them in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ours before cooking—this allows the flavors to infuse deeply. Additionally, you can prepare the garlic butter sauce (just combine the butter and minced garlic) and store it in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. When you’re ready to serve, simply heat the skillet, sear the chicken thighs for that crispy skin, add the prepared sauce, and continue baking as directed. What if my chicken isn’t crispy after baking?
If your chicken doesn’t turn crispy, it may not have been patted dry enough before cooking, or it might have been crowded in the pan. To prevent this, ensure each thigh has ample space in the skillet, and consider using a higher heat during searing to promote a golden crust.

How do I reheat the chicken without drying it out?
To retain the juiciness,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and place the chicken thighs on a baking dish. Drizzle a little fresh garlic butter over them, cover with foil, and heat for about 15-20 minutes or until warmed through. This method helps keep the meat moist while reviving that delicious garlic flavor!
